Question: What is an interface in robotics?

Within the context of robotics, Zhang gives a definition for HMI: “A human–machine interface in a robotic system is a terminal that allows the human operator to control, monitor, and collect data, and can also be used to program the system”. … ISO 8373 distinguishes between two types of robots.

What is an interface and how does it apply to robotics?

In the interface design for a robotic system, design decisions represent the state of embodied agents or avatars and the Graphical User interface that allows the user to command and interact with the robot itself.

What is API in robotics?

Robotics API, a Java library for programming applications for (industrial) robots, including a robot control core for simulation purposes. Realtime RCC, a robot control core with real-time guarantees. 3D Visualization for Robotics API applications.

What does M mean in robotics?

M. Manipulator or gripper. A robotic ‘hand’.

What does it mean to interface with someone?

interface Add to list Share. … Used as a verb, interface means to merge or mingle, bonding and synthesizing by communicating and working together. The word interface is comprised of the prefix inter, which means “between,” and face.

How do robots know where they are?

LIDAR is a technology that uses a laser to measure distance. Lasers illuminate objects in an environment and reflect the light back. The robot analyzes these reflections to create a map of its environment. LIDAR tells robots what is around them and where it is located.

Is RPA an API?

Robotic Process Automation (RPA) is a surface level automation software which can be used for applications to talk to each other. Application Programming Interface (API) on the other hand is a standardized layer of software integration code which allows applications to talk to each other.

Is RPA integration?

Often Robotic Process Automation (RPA) is about moving information between two or more separate pieces of software. However, getting separate systems to talk to each other is not a new problem and RPA is not the only way to solve it. … System integration has been around already for a while.

Is RPA an integration tool?

Yet, while a lot is known about RPA’s capability to automate mundane data heavy processes, little is said about its ability to act as an integration tool.

What is pounce position in robotics?

A “pounce position” is an arbitrary point used BEFORE (and usually AFTER also) a series of points defining a path. In your case, a welding path. The Pounce Position is used to safely park the arm+tool in a convenient location ready to move to the beginning point of the path.

What Scara means?

“SCARA” stands for Selective Compliance Assembly Robot Arm or Selective Compliance Articulated Robot Arm.

What is interface example?

An interface is a description of the actions that an object can do… for example when you flip a light switch, the light goes on, you don’t care how, just that it does. In Object Oriented Programming, an Interface is a description of all functions that an object must have in order to be an “X”.

Why is interfacing needed?

When we are executing any instruction, we need the microprocessor to access the memory for reading instruction codes and the data stored in the memory. … The interfacing circuit therefore should be designed in such a way that it matches the memory signal requirements with the signals of the microprocessor.

What is a technology interface?

(n.) A boundary across which two independent systems meet and act on or communicate with each other. In computer technology, there are several types of interfaces. user interface – the keyboard, mouse, menus of a computer system. The user interface allows the user to communicate with the operating system.